- Antiretroviral Therapy: Antiretroviral therapy (ART) remains the most effective approach for managing HIV/AIDS. This treatment involves administering a combination of medications specifically designed to suppress the replication of the virus in the body. The primary goal of ART is to reduce the viral load to undetectable levels, preserve immune function, and prevent disease progression. These medications are categorized based on their mechanisms of action and include several classes, each targeting different stages of the HIV lifecycle. Proper adherence to ART is crucial for its success, and ongoing medical supervision ensures optimal treatment outcomes.
- Classes of HIV Medications: The main categories of antiretroviral drugs encompass:
- Non-nucleoside Reverse Transcriptase Inhibitors (NNRTIs): These drugs inhibit the reverse transcriptase enzyme, essential for the virus to convert its RNA into DNA, a critical step in its replication process. By targeting this enzyme, NNRTIs prevent HIV from copying itself within host cells.
- Nucleoside and Nucleotide Reverse Transcriptase Inhibitors (NRTIs): Acting as faulty building blocks, NRTIs interfere with the reverse transcriptase enzyme's ability to synthesize viral DNA, thereby halting viral proliferation.
- Protease Inhibitors (PIs): These block the protease enzyme, which HIV needs to process the viral proteins crucial for producing infectious viral particles. This inhibition results in immature, non-infectious virus particles.
- Entry and Fusion Inhibitors: These medications prevent HIV from entering CD4 cells—the primary cells of the immune system—by blocking the virus's ability to fuse with the cell membrane. This mechanism effectively stops the initial stage of infection within host cells.
- Integrase Inhibitors: These drugs target the integrase enzyme, which HIV uses to insert its genetic material into the DNA of host CD4 cells. Inhibiting this step prevents the integration of viral DNA, thus halting the propagation of the virus.
Combining these drug classes appropriately forms the backbone of effective HIV treatment. Tailored combinations are determined by healthcare providers based on the patient's condition and viral resistance patterns. Adherence to prescribed regimens is vital to suppress viral replication and prevent drug resistance.
- Preventing Opportunistic Infections and Dietary Management: Since HIV weakens the immune system over time, individuals living with HIV are at risk of developing opportunistic infections—illnesses that occur more frequently or are more severe due to immunodeficiency. Preventative measures include prophylactic treatments, vaccinations, and stringent hygiene practices to minimize exposure to infectious agents.
- Nutritional Support: Maintaining a balanced diet rich in essential micronutrients, vitamins, and minerals plays a pivotal role in supporting immune function and enhancing overall health. A nutritious diet can help mitigate side effects of medications, boost energy levels, and strengthen the body's defenses against infections.
